Why Silence Stifles Transformation in SpinQuest
SpinQuest symbolizes the inward battle—a descent into self-awareness where participants confront core issues often buried deep beneath layers of denial. Yet, despite shared stories of struggle in this space, many avoid probing these uncomfortable truths. Why? Because discussing topics like fear of failure beyond applause, shame tied to vulnerability, or societal expectations around emotional strength challenges deeply held beliefs about success, masculinity, and resilience.
Ignoring these issues leads to stagnation. When individuals refuse to name their unspoken resistance—such as “I’m too afraid to be too broken” or “I can’t show weakness even when it’s necessary”—they build walls around healing. The journey becomes superficial rather than transformative.

The Uncomfortable Topics People Avoid
-
The Paradox of Perfectionism
Many enter SpinQuest seeking liberation, yet harbor an unspoken terror of losing the illusion of control. The belief that “being strong means having answers” prevents genuine introspection. Admitting uncertainty undermines self-image, forcing silence rather than courage. -
Emotional Vulnerability as Weakness
Cultural narratives often paint vulnerability as a flaw. Participants resist acknowledging fears like “I can’t cry without losing myself,” or “Showing pain makes me unworthy.” This shame blocks connection and authentic emotional processing, which are critical for healing. -
Conflict with External Expectations
Society frequently rewards stoicism, especially in high-pressure environments. Many refuse to discuss how family, peers, or workplace cultures demand relentless positivity—making it hard to voice inner struggles without risking judgment or ostracization. -
Fear of Not ‘Deserving’ Growth
Some carry deep-seated beliefs life’s hardships are a punishment or unearned suffering. This mindset inhibits reflection on personal patterns, making it difficult to commit to transformative work. Open dialogue would challenge these beliefs—but few dare.

How Embracing Unspoken Truths Deepens SpinQuest
Raw honesty about these denied realities transforms the journey. When individuals dare to voice: “I’m scared to stop pretending,” or “I can’t silence the voices that judge me,” they break isolation. Peer acknowledgment of these taboos fosters compassion, reframing silence not as failure but as a courageous starting point.
SpinQuest coaches and facilitators play a vital role here—not just by guiding practice, but by creating safe spaces where confession feels brave, not shameful.
